void-packages/srcpkgs/tracker/template

56 lines
1.9 KiB
Text
Raw Normal View History

2011-10-03 09:19:57 +00:00
# Template file for 'tracker'
pkgname=tracker
2013-08-03 14:30:19 +00:00
version=0.16.2
2013-05-02 07:51:47 +00:00
revision=1
build_style=gnu-configure
2011-10-03 09:19:57 +00:00
configure_args="--enable-libflac --enable-libvorbis --disable-unit-tests
2012-10-15 14:48:35 +00:00
--enable-libtiff --disable-static --enable-network-manager"
hostmakedepends="pkg-config intltool gobject-introspection"
2013-04-30 09:39:39 +00:00
makedepends="libpng-devel>=1.6 libgee-devel libsecret-devel upower-devel
exempi-devel poppler-glib-devel gupnp-dlna-devel libgxps-devel
2012-10-15 14:48:35 +00:00
libgsf-devel icu-devel>=49 enca-devel libvorbis-devel libflac-devel
taglib-devel giflib-devel>=5.0 totem-pl-parser-devel
2012-10-15 14:48:35 +00:00
libexif-devel tiff-devel network-manager-applet-devel sqlite-devel"
2011-10-03 09:19:57 +00:00
short_desc="Personal search tool and storage system"
maintainer="Juan RP <xtraeme@gmail.com>"
2011-10-13 17:03:41 +00:00
license="GPL-2"
2012-06-06 08:30:04 +00:00
homepage="http://live.gnome.org/Tracker"
distfiles="${GNOME_SITE}/$pkgname/0.16/$pkgname-$version.tar.xz"
2013-08-03 14:30:19 +00:00
checksum=033394636835628e01eb90efb55883fd88ec581910915b5948081f8f41df7409
2011-10-03 09:19:57 +00:00
long_desc="
Tracker trawls through your data and organises it so that it can be retrieved
extremely quickly later on via simple searches. This organisation puts your
data into categories so that application like photo managers and music players
can instantly find relevant content automatically. Tracker enables you to tag
your data with keywords which can be used to find related information or to
group and categorise your data further. Tracker lets you extend your data
with additional metadata."
tracker-devel_package() {
depends="libglib-devel libtracker-${version}_${revision}"
2013-04-30 09:39:39 +00:00
short_desc+=" - development files"
pkg_install() {
vmove usr/include
vmove usr/share/gir-1.0
vmove usr/share/gtk-doc
vmove usr/share/vala
vmove usr/lib/pkgconfig
2013-08-03 14:30:19 +00:00
vmove "usr/lib/*.so"
}
}
libtracker_package() {
2013-04-30 09:39:39 +00:00
short_desc+=" - shared libraries"
pkg_install() {
2013-08-03 14:30:19 +00:00
vmove "usr/lib/*.so.*"
vmove "usr/lib/tracker-0.16/*.so*"
vmove usr/lib/girepository-1.0
}
}
tracker_package() {
pkg_install() {
2013-04-30 09:39:39 +00:00
vmove all
}
}